Rape Perpetrators Found Guilty

At Hull Crown Court on Tuesday, 4 February, a jury delivered a unanimous verdict convicting a couple of a horrific rape

Anthony Preston, 22, and Nicole Rickatson, 27, both from Allendale, Hull, were found guilty of rape and perverting the course of justice. Their criminal actions unfolded in December 2023 when the victim visited their home, a location that quickly transformed into a scene of unimaginable trauma.

Detailed Criminal Investigation

Detective Constable Thomas Birkenhead from the Protecting Vulnerable People Unit provided crucial insights into the sexual assault conviction. “Both Rickatson and Preston exploited the victim’s trust, pinning her down and committing a brutal sexual assault for their own gratification,” he stated.

Evidence and Legal Proceedings

The investigation revealed multiple layers of criminal behaviour:

  • Preston attempted to remove evidence from the crime scene
  • The couple denied their actions, forcing the victim to relive her traumatic experience
  • Forensic evidence was crucial in securing the conviction

Legal Consequences

Both Preston and Rickatson have been remanded in custody, with sentencing scheduled for Monday, 17 March at Hull Crown Court.
